Travelled from Essex with one other adult and three small dogs for two nights at this hotel. on arrival such a friendly welcome, and dogs were doted over by all the staff. Staff were extremely accommodating, from offering advice where we could walk the dogs to do their business, allowing us to have early breakfast in the bar when we had a day of travelling, room service if we didn’t want to leave the dogs in the room but not a problem as dogs are allowed in the bar where we could eat, and they were quite happy sitting under the table munching the treats the staff gave them. They also went out of their way to print some documents we had forgotten to bring with us. The room was suitable for our needs, very nice, and dog friendly (as was the whole hotel to be honest). We had dinner at the bar twice, and both meals were very pleasant and a nice calm atmosphere. The area is also very lovely, and ideal for dog owners, as there is a park/walkway alongside the golf course virtually opposite the hotel, with an amazing view of the sea. We got very lucky with the sunny weather on our visit. We also got up early to visit the beach which is only about a 6 minute walk from the hotel, and has some amazing views. All in all a lovely hotel with brilliant staff who went out of their way for us, cannot find fault at all. The area is so lovely and quiet, but close enough to main venues (for us the dog show), some stunning views in walking distance. Would highly recommend.
